Dans ce tutoriel, nous allons vous montrer comment installer MAAS sur Ubuntu 20.04 LTS. Pour ceux d’entre vous qui ne le savaient pas, MAAS (Metal as a Service) propose un provisionnement de style cloud pour les serveurs physiques. Il est open source et gratuit, avec un support commercial disponible auprès de Canonical. Cet outil est très utile pour les entreprises normales dans la gestion d’infrastructures virtualisées. MAAS est pris en charge sur les systèmes d’exploitation Ubuntu, CentOS, Windows et RedHat.
Cet article suppose que vous avez au moins des connaissances de base sur Linux, que vous savez utiliser le shell et, plus important encore, que vous hébergez votre site sur votre propre VPS. L’installation est assez simple et suppose que vous utilisez le compte root, sinon vous devrez peut-être ajouter ‘sudo
‘ aux commandes pour obtenir les privilèges root. Je vais vous montrer l’installation étape par étape de MAAS sur Ubuntu 20.04 (Focal Fossa). Vous pouvez suivre les mêmes instructions pour Ubuntu 18.04, 16.04 et toute autre distribution basée sur Debian comme Linux Mint.
Installer MAAS sur Ubuntu 20.04 LTS Focal Fossa
Étape 1. Tout d’abord, assurez-vous que tous vos packages système sont à jour en exécutant ce qui suit apt
commandes dans le terminal.
sudo mise à jour appropriée
sudo mise à niveau appropriée
Étape 2. Installation de MAAS sur Ubuntu 20.04.
Par défaut, MAAS n’est pas disponible sur le référentiel de base Ubuntu. Exécutez maintenant la commande suivante ci-dessous pour installer MAAS à l’aide de Snap Store :
sudo installation instantanée maas
Étape 3. Installation de PostgreSQL.
Par défaut, PostgreSQL n’est pas disponible pour une installation directe à partir du référentiel de base Debian 11. Maintenant, nous ajoutons le référentiel PostgreSQL officiel à votre système :
echo “deb [signed-by=/usr/share/keyrings/postgresql-keyring.gpg] https://apt.postgresql.org/pub/repos/apt/bullseye-pgdg main” | sudo tee /etc/apt/sources.list.d/postgresql.list
Ensuite, importez la clé de signature PostgreSQL :
curl -fsSL https://www.postgresql.org/media/keys/ACCC4CF8.asc | sudo gpg –dearmor -o /usr/share/keyrings/postgresql-keyring.gpg
Enfin, exécutez la commande suivante ci-dessous pour installer PostgreSQL :
sudo mise à jour appropriée
sudo apt installer postgresql-13
Après avoir installé PostgreSQL, démarrez le service PostgreSQL et activez-le au redémarrage du système :
sudo systemctl démarrer postgresql
sudo systemctl activer postgresql
sudo état systemctl postgresql
Après cela, nous créerons une base de données pour MAAS. Ici, la base de données s’appelle maas_db
, utilisateur nommé maasuser
, le mot de passe est idroot123
:
sudo -u postgres psql crée la base de données maas_db ; q
Ensuite, éditez le fichier /etc/postgresql/10/main/pg_hba.conf
:
sudo nano /etc/postgresql/10/main/pg_hba.conf
Ajoutez la ligne suivante :
hôte maas maaszeljko 0/0 md5
Save et close puis, commencez à initialiser MAAS :
sudo maas init region+rack –database-uri “postgres://maasuser :[email protected]/maas_db”
Ensuite, créez le admin compte pour l’interface Web, exécutez :
sudo maas createadmin
Étape 4. Accéder à l’interface Web MAAS.
Une fois installé avec succès, ouvrez votre navigateur Web et tapez l’URL https://your-ip-addrees
. Vous devriez voir l’écran d’interface MAAS :
Toutes nos félicitations! Vous avez correctement installé MAAS. Merci d’avoir utilisé ce didacticiel pour installer MAAS sur le système Ubuntu 20.04 LTS Focal Fossa. Pour une aide supplémentaire ou des informations utiles, nous vous recommandons de vérifier le site officiel du MAAS.